Lactalis American Group, part of the Lactalis family of companies, is currently hiring a Senior Manager, Site Support based in Nampa, Idaho.

As a Senior Manager, Site Support, the role will carry out responsibilities such as overseeing the daily maintenance operations across our Lactalis American Group plants in Nampa, Idaho. This role involves managing a skilled team, ensuring efficient maintenance of utilities systems (steam, refrigeration, air, and water), and leading key functions such as parts ordering, metal fabrication, and general machinery upkeep. A major focus of this position is the development and delivery of in-house training programs to build team expertise, reduce downtime, and enhance the overall mechanical reliability of plant operations. By coordinating across multiple plants, the Senior Manager, Site Support ensures that all systems function optimally, meeting regulatory compliance and safety standards, while also driving process improvements that reduce costs and improve operational performance. This role plays a vital part in maintaining the efficiency, safety, and quality of the plant environment, directly impacting production capacity and reliability.

Key responsibilities for this position include:

Team Leadership & Training:

  • Lead and manage a team of skilled maintenance technicians and managers.
  • Prioritize team training to build core competencies in mechanical, electrical, programming, and refrigeration systems.
  • Partner with the training team to develop in-house training programs to ensure accurate and timely evaluations and repairs of systems.
  • Foster a proactive and skilled maintenance team that meets the needs of plant operations.

Maintenance Operations:

  • Oversee the maintenance and operation of utilities systems (steam, compressed air, refrigeration, and water).
  • Manage parts ordering to ensure timely availability and cost-effective solutions.
  • Coordinate with various teams to ensure all systems are working optimally and meet safety and compliance standards.
  • Facilities & Equipment Oversight:
  • Manage the operation and maintenance of the steam system, ammonia refrigeration systems, air compressors, dryers, and wastewater systems.
  • Perform hands-on maintenance and repair work, including troubleshooting, root cause analysis, and repairing mechanical, electrical, and utility systems to ensure plant equipment operates efficiently and reliably. Cutting, bending, welding and assembling stainless steel at times is critical to the operation. Being Involved in the identification of the need, and fabrication of highly customized parts that can be integrated into current equipment to gain efficiency and productivity is an important role.
  • Implement safety rules and ensure compliance with environmental regulations, including OSHA, EPA, FDA, and other external regulatory standards.

Process Improvement & Cost Management:

  • Lead and execute continuous improvement initiatives to streamline operations and enhance performance.
  • Develop and implement strategies to reduce downtime, improve reliability, and lower maintenance costs.
  • Ensure maintenance project costs are within budget and regularly update senior management on financial status.

Safety & Quality Assurance:

  • Champion safety, environmental, and quality initiatives, ensuring all team members follow established protocols.
  • Be involved in hazard analysis and risk prevention to ensure a safe working environment for all staff.

Cross-Plant Coordination:

  • Work across the Nampa plants, ensuring consistent maintenance practices and optimal system performance at each facility.
  • Collaborate with the plant directors and project managers to schedule and prioritize maintenance tasks across all sites.

Requirements

From your STORY to ours

Qualified applicants will contribute the following:

Education

  • A bachelor's degree is recommended.
  • A major in industrial or mechanical engineering or a related field is preferred.

Experience

  • 8+ years in a progressively responsible maintenance role, with at least 4 years in a management position, is required.
  • Experience in managing maintenance in a food manufacturing facility or similar environment.

Certifications and specific knowledge

  • The following certifications are favored for this role: CMRP, CFSP, CMT, RETA, or GCAP.
  • Strong leadership skills to build and manage a team.
  • Expertise in steam systems, refrigeration, air systems, and water systems.
  • Ability to interpret technical instructions and troubleshoot mechanical, electrical, and refrigeration issues.
  • Proficiency with CMMS software (e.g., Maximo) and MS Office tools.
  • Strong communication skills and the ability to work well with others in a collaborative environment.
  • Self-motivated with the ability to thrive in a fast-paced environment.
